Dredd 3D



I had wanted to see this when it hit theaters last year. But the shitty theater in town didn't get it. So I had to wait on Blu ray to see it.

First off I am so happy this ,unlike that Stallone piece of shit,follows the mythos of the comic. We are dropped right into the story and not force fed a bunch of exposition to explain the world. Which is a nice touch. Karl Urban is amazing as Judge Dredd completely buries himself in the role. Olivia Thrilby is a great Judge Anderson. And Lena Headey is a very convincing villain.

The film is the about Judge Anderson's first day as a Judge. She is sent out with Dredd to be evaluated. They hear about 3 murders in one of Megacity 1's megablocks. 200 levels tall,and filled with thousands of people,this block turns out to be one of the most crime ridden places in the megacity. A gang ran by Mama runs the block and is busy manufacturing a new drug known as Slow-Mo. Anderson and Dredd manage to capture one of the main dealers of Slow-Mo and they are gonna take him back to HQ to question him. Mama's freaks out and puts the block on lock down. So for the next hour or so we get both Judges fighting off most of the residents of the block. This is what an action movie should be. Fuck Expendables and most other action films from the past 5 years. Dredd is a perfect blend of action and dark humor. Once it gets going the action doesn't slow down. There is some neat twists along the way. And all the actors/actresses do a great job.

I like how most of the city,the megablock and other stuff looks very close to how it looks in 2000 AD comics. Sadly this film seems to have been a bomb in the USA. I blame this on two things. First even amongst comic fans Judge Dredd isn't well known. Plus I believe that horrible Stallone Judge Dredd movie from years ago scared off people. I am hoping this does great on home video. If it does we might get a sequel.

I wish I could have seen this in a theater to see it in 3d. But on Blu Ray it looked great. The sound was also well done. Dredd 3d gets a A-.
